Ordinals
beta
Sat 1305320974090653
decimal
312128.974090653
degree
0°102128′1664″974090653‴
percentile
62.15814169173841%
name
epikkxuhqvc
cycle
0
epoch
1
period
154
block
312128
offset
974090653
timestamp
2014-07-23 15:00:02 UTC
rarity
common
prev
next